About This Opportunity
The TiE Young Entrepreneurs (TYE) program, a flagship global initiative by The Indus Entrepreneurs (TiE), is meticulously designed to cultivate an entrepreneurial mindset and leadership qualities among high school students across India. This immersive, experiential education program guides aspiring young innovators through every critical stage of building a startup, from initial ideation and in-depth market research to comprehensive business planning and compelling pitching.
Participants benefit from dynamic classroom sessions led by seasoned entrepreneurs and industry professionals, coupled with invaluable personalized mentoring from senior industry leaders. The program culminates in a highly competitive regional business plan competition, where winning teams earn the prestigious opportunity to advance to the global competition held in the USA.
TYE is committed to instilling an entrepreneurial spirit, fostering critical 21st-century skills such as creative thinking, complex problem-solving, effective teamwork, and impactful leadership. The curriculum is robust, often covering essential business concepts like Lean Canvas methodology, Design Thinking principles, achieving Product-Market Fit, fundamental finance, strategic marketing, and crucial legal aspects of business.
TYE is actively run by various prominent TiE chapters across India, including Delhi-NCR, Hyderabad, Jaipur, Kanpur, Ahmedabad, Kolkata, and Chennai, ensuring widespread accessibility and regional relevance.

Open to high school students in Grades 9-12 (typically ages 14-19) residing in cities with active TiE chapters across India. Applicants must be highly motivated, possess a strong interest in entrepreneurship, and be willing to work collaboratively in teams.
